Quote:
Originally Posted by zoner View Post
This is one of my 'this weekend' projects... any tricks/tips you can share regarding the install? I was looking at the tutorial on understeer.com- looks like it's pretty straightforward.
Best tip I can give is to not use the understeer tool. That's what I tried first and ended up breaking a grade 8.8 bolt off in the half clamped nutsert.

I had to cut off the nut/bolt/washers and then punch the nutsert into the subframe. Then I put a new nutsert in using the McMaster tool (# 96349A815) the tool worked like a charm, so much easier than the dumb bolt/nut combo.
